.checkbox{display:grid;gap:.75rem;grid-template-columns:min-content auto}.checkbox .control{display:inline-grid;height:1.5rem;width:1.5rem;border-radius:.25rem;background-image:none}.checkbox .input{display:grid;grid-template-areas:"checkbox"}.checkbox .input>*{grid-area:checkbox}.checkbox .input input{height:1.5rem;width:1.5rem;opacity:0}.checkbox .input input:checked+.control{border-width:1px;border-color:#3a99da;background-image:url("data:image/svg+xml,%3Csvg width='16' height='16' viewBox='0 0 16 16'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M14.2222 0H1.77778C0.795556 0 0 0.795556 0 1.77778V14.2222C0 15.2044 0.795556 16 1.77778 16H14.2222C15.2044 16 16 15.2044 16 14.2222V1.77778C16 0.795556 15.2044 0 14.2222 0ZM6.22222 12.4444L1.77778 8L3.03556 6.74222L6.22222 9.92889L12.9644 3.18667L14.2222 4.44444L6.22222 12.4444Z' fill='url(%23paint0_linear)' /%3E%3Cdefs%3E%3ClinearGradient id='paint0_linear' x1='8' y1='0' x2='8' y2='16' gradientUnits='userSpaceOnUse'%3E%3Cstop offset='1' stop-color='%233498DB' /%3E%3Cstop offset='1' stop-color='%2334B3DB' /%3E%3C/linearGradient%3E%3C/defs%3E%3C/svg%3E")}.select{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-image:url("data:image/svg+xml,%3Csvg width='16' height='10' viewBox='0 0 16 10'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M1.88667 0.0566406L8 6.16997L14.1133 0.0566406L16 1.94331L8 9.94331L0 1.94331L1.88667 0.0566406Z' fill='url(%23paint0_linear)'/%3E%3Cdefs%3E%3ClinearGradient id='paint0_linear' x1='8' y1='0.0566406' x2='8' y2='9.94331' gradientUnits='userSpaceOnUse'%3E%3Cstop stop-color='%233498DB'/%3E%3Cstop offset='1' stop-color='%2334B3DB'/%3E%3C/linearGradient%3E%3C/defs%3E%3C/svg%3E%0A");background-repeat:no-repeat,repeat;background-position:right .7em top 50%,0 0;background-size:1.25rem auto,100%}.select--black{background-image:url("data:image/svg+xml,%3Csvg width='16' height='10' viewBox='0 0 16 10'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M2.04169 0.0551758L8.08778 6.17057L14.1339 0.0551758L15.9998 1.94248L8.08778 9.94518L0.175781 1.94248L2.04169 0.0551758Z' fill='black' fill-opacity='0.87'/%3E%3C/svg%3E%0A")}.filters-wrapper{max-height:calc(100vh - 90px)}@media(min-width:1024px){.filters-wrapper{max-height:100%}}
